在使用MySQL時,有時我們需要修改數據庫端口。雖然MySQL的默認端口是3306,但是有些實際場景下,我們需要修改數據庫端口以符合我們的需求。
在這篇文章中,我們將學習如何改變MySQL數據庫端口。
1.連接到MySQL服務器
首先,我們需要連接到MySQL服務器。我們可以使用以下命令進行連接:
$ mysql -u root -p
要將端口綁定到特定的IP地址上,請使用以下命令:
$ mysql -h IP_ADDRESS -u root -p
2.修改MySQL的配置文件
找到my.cnf或my.ini文件,可以使用以下命令查找該文件在系統中的位置:
$ which mysql
輸出應該看起來類似于這樣:
/usr/local/mysql/bin/mysql
現在使用以下命令打開my.cnf或my.ini:
$ sudo vi /etc/mysql/my.cnf
或
$ sudo vi /etc/mysql/my.ini
3.更改端口
找到my.cnf或my.ini文件中的“端口=”項。將其更改為所需的端口。例如,要將端口更改為7777,請使用以下命令:
port = 7777
如果您使用的是Windows操作系統,請在my.ini文件中查找“port=”項,然后將其更改為所需的端口。
4.保存并退出文件
完成更改后,請保存并退出my.cnf或my.ini文件。
5.重新啟動MySQL服務器
使用以下命令重新啟動MySQL服務器:
$ sudo service mysql restart
6.檢查端口更改是否生效
如果您已成功更改端口,則應該可以使用新端口連接到MySQL服務器。使用以下命令檢查MySQL服務器是否在新端口上運行:
$ sudo netstat -lnp | grep mysql
輸出應該顯示MySQL服務器正在偵聽新端口:
tcp6 0 0 :::7777 :::* LISTEN 28481/mysqld
恭喜你,你已改變MySQL數據庫端口!
上一篇css怎么給圖片變顏色
下一篇css怎么給列表加圖標